1. A method of printing with a print assembly having first and second print engines arranged in an opposing in-line sequential configuration along a paper path, the method comprising the steps of:
- drawing a sheet of paper into the first print engine;
printing image data onto the sheet via the first and second print engines;
printing fixative onto the paper to aid drying of ink; and
binding the printed sheet into a document using a binding assembly of the print assembly,wherein the step of binding includes passing the printed sheet between a powered spike wheel axle with a fibrous support roller and a movable axle with spike wheels and a momentary action glue wheel, the movable axle and glue wheel mounted to a metal support bracket and moved to interface with the powered axle via gears by action of a camshaft, in use.

Abstract
Provided is a method of printing with a print assembly having first and second print engines arranged in an opposing in-line sequential configuration along a paper path. The method includes the steps of drawing a sheet of paper into the first print engine, printing image data onto the sheet via the first and second print engines, printing fixative onto the paper to aid drying of ink, and binding the printed sheet into a document using a binding assembly of the print assembly.
